原创 oracle client 下載安裝配置使用

2020 年第一篇 請多關照 首先下載一個ORACLE client 客戶端 下載地址鏈接:https://pan.baidu.com/s/1V5c6ltDGEt77p6Vz3Nc9iQ  提取碼:0pkg   下載好之後本地安裝解壓- 

原创 刪除mysql57服務

刪除mysql57服務  直接打開cmd 終端 輸入sc delete mysql57

原创 kettle連接數據庫,官方jdbc jar包下載以及佈置安裝

我們在配置kettle 的spoon服務器時候,然後鏈接mysql的服務器的鏈接,可是怎麼也連不上,怎麼也連不上,這時候我們的小夥伴就很發愁,第一反應是配置錯了,可是仔細看配置沒錯,哈哈哈沒關係,我們先看看我報的錯     錯誤連接數據庫

原创 win10 下面配置jdk1.8

首先我們去官網下載http://www.oracle.com/technetwork/java/javase/downloads/jdk8-downloads-2133151.html進去之後我們按照如下圖所示之後下載到本地之後,我們開始

原创 win10下kettle安裝

首先我們先下載一個kettle的安裝包鏈接如下https://pan.baidu.com/s/1J5MlxdThL2RSTFj43rpcoQ下載完成後解壓因爲這個kettke是需要jdk的輔助的,所以要在電腦上安裝一個jdk,可以搜索我的

原创 連接mysql8.0報錯plugin caching_sha2_password could not be loaded

只需如下幾步; 1.打開cmd 輸入mysql -uroot -p 然後輸入密碼進入到mysql 2. ALTER USER 'root'@'localhost' IDENTIFIED BY 'password' PASSWORD EX

原创 查看mysql版本,查看oracle版本,查看sqlserver版本

mysql:select version() oracle:select * from v$instance   sqlserver:SELECT @@VERSION

原创 oracle將date格式的數據生成13位時間戳,oracle生成當前時間戳

生成當前時間戳:select (sysdate-to_date('1970-01-01 08:00:00','yyyy-mm-dd hh24:mi:ss'))*1000*24*3600  from dual  date格式數據生成時間戳:

原创 kettle連接sqlserver數據庫(jar包)

sqljdbc地址:http://mvnrepository.com/artifact/microsoft/sqljdbc  sqljdbc4地址:http://www.java2s.com/Code/Jar/s/Downloadsqlj

原创 Mysql密碼重置

首先找到mysql的安裝目錄 然後跳到他的bin目錄下 按回車會彈出一個終端出來, 然後輸入mysqld --skip-grant-tables 按回車。 --skip-grant-tables 的意思是啓動MySQL服務的時候跳過權限

原创 Kettle從入門到放棄,值得收藏

【Kettle從零開始】一之Kettle簡單介紹     http://blog.csdn.net/rotkang/article/details/20810921【Kettle從零開始】二之Kettle文件夾與界面介紹http://bl

原创 sql時間函數轉換

unix_timestamp(now())*1000 生成當前時間戳 SELECT UNIX_TIMESTAMP('2017-01-01 00:00:00')*1000 將日期生成爲13位時間戳 SELECT FROM_UNIXTIME(

原创 Mysql生日數據時間戳爲負數轉換

這個也是工作中的一個問題 我剛開始以爲這個數據可以用from_unixtime來解決,可是當我輸入負數的時候,我錯了。 他不識別啊 首先下面的是正數 那我吧這個數字改爲負數發現 他爲null 後來把這個sql改成了 有沒有很神奇的樣子

原创 數據傾斜解決方案之使用隨機key實現雙重聚合

使用隨機key實現雙重聚合 1、原理 2、使用場景 (1)groupByKey (2)reduceByKey 比較適合使用這種方式;join,咱們通常不會這樣來做,後面會講三種,針對不同的join造成的數據傾斜的問題的解決方案。 第一輪聚

原创 數據傾斜解決方案之聚合源數據

數據傾斜的解決,跟之前講解的性能調優,有一點異曲同工之妙。 性能調優,跟大家講過一個道理,“重劍無鋒”。性能調優,調了半天,最有效,最直接,最簡單的方式,就是加資源,加並行度,注意RDD架構(複用同一個RDD,加上cache緩存);shu